Transaction 34c9d91206e2100f24dd438bf5695258697c86da37fb85a267a12ceb8bd10ad7

2 Input
2 Outputs
  • 34c9d91206e2100f24dd438bf5695258697c86da37fb85a267a12ceb8bd10ad7:0
  • value  451000
    address  3A41YVNDne8FTrqi3wFYgaUWuguCu6VpGv
  • 34c9d91206e2100f24dd438bf5695258697c86da37fb85a267a12ceb8bd10ad7:1
  • value  23216918
    address  3LGmEpKkKAoYuD8p4J7amyCH3fX8xYTQk1